Role Summary:

We are working with the Orlando Magic in their hiring process for a Manual Therapist. The ideal candidate may possess a background in Physical Therapy, Athletic Training, Osteopathic Medicine, or any physiological field of study with a focus on Manual Therapy. This staff member will collaborate with other high performance staff members in the areas of strength and conditioning, athletic training, physical therapy, sports science, nutrition, sports psychology, massage, chiropractic care, and our designated team doctors. The Manual Therapist will be an integral part of the sports medicine team and will be needed to work as a full-time traveling member of multidisciplinary high performance staff in the NBA.

Responsibilities:

-Work as a full time traveling member of multidisciplinary high performance staff in the NBA

-Collaborate with other high performance staff members in the areas of strength and conditioning, athletic training, physical therapy, sports science, nutrition, sports psychology, massage, chiropractic care, and our designated team doctors 

-Strong and confident skill set in the evaluation, diagnosis, and treatment of athletic injuries both acute and chronic

-Skilled in daily maintenance player treatments addressing symptoms head to toe as well as recovery based treatment sessions

-Knowledge of common basketball related injuries and injury reduction strategies

-Knowledge of an NBA basketball season and in season game demands

-Skilled and confident in post-surgical rehab and return to sport timeframes

-Ability to recognize the need to refer to our team doctors, outside medical providers, or to another staff member to utilize a more optimal skill set

-Coordination with the performance staff on symptom and injury based gym modifications, post injury or surgical rehab cases, and injury reduction strategies

-Be an active participant in preseason screening processes, including physicals, to address athlete wellness and injury risk 

-Maintain records and player documentation of treatments, rehabilitation, and collection of medical data

-Assist with all medical staff duties including inventory, training room operation and cleanliness, emergency action plans, supplies, evaluation of new equipment and technology, and other duties as directed 

-Awareness and a knowledge surrounding usability of testing and monitoring technologies such as force plate testing, velocity-based training, Nordbord/GroinBar, athlete wellness monitoring, HR monitors, and player tracking technologies 

-Exploration of research, technology, and/or products to enhance player performance, recovery, and overall athlete well being

-Ability to make more informed decisions by understanding and collaborating on the collection and use of athlete data with our applied sports scientist and other high performance staff members 

-Meet daily to collaborate and engage in discussions with other sports medicine and performance staff members

Required Qualifications:

-Ability to work and provide medical care full time, year round, and for the entirety of the NBA season (82+ games)

-At least 5 years of experience working directly with athletes in a collegiate, Olympic, and/or professional level setting

-University degree in an kinesiology, physiology, exercise science, osteopathic medicine, athletic training, or physical therapy with an anatomy emphasis

-Masters or Doctorate level degree preferred 

-Understanding of the functionality of a high performance team and a desire to be a key contributor with a collaborative and adaptive team based mindset

-Exceptional communication skills and awareness of one's self

-Effective time management and organizational skills

-Responds effectively to daily environmental changes and on the fly decision making situations

-Commitment to continuous learning

-Must have current U.S. work authorization

Desired Qualifications (in No Particular Order):

-Massage therapy/ Lymphatic drainage techniques

-Active Release Technique

-Dry Needling or Acupuncture

-Fascial Manipulation/Fascial Stretch Training/Myofascial release/etc

-Neural/Visceral Manipulation

-Manual Articular Approach treatments/ Integrated systems approach/Connect therapy

-Joint Manipulation including alignment interventions

-Skilled and efficient in athletic taping/kinesio taping

-Padding and Bracing Interventional strategies

-Concussion Management

-Dynamic Neuromuscular Stabilization (DNS) 

-Mobility assessment training via SFMA,FMS, or Functional Range Conditioning

-Clinical Neuroscience

-Cupping Therapy

-Blood Flow Restriction Therapy

-Diagnostic use of Musculoskeletal Ultrasound

-Knowledge of sports recovery technology and strategies

-Performance Enhancement Specialist (PES)

-Correctional Exercise Specialist (CES)

-Certified Strength and Conditioning Specialist (CSCS)

-PT: MPT/DPT/Orthopaedic certified specialist (OCS) / Sports Certified Specialist (SCS)

-ATC: Certified Athletic Trainer/LAT

-Osteopathic/Manual Therapist

-CPR/first aid/AED/Emergency Responder training
